Watch TV One Tree Hill Season 6 Episode 19 on 123movies

« Episode 18 ( Season 6 | See All 192 Episodes ) Episode 20 »

One Tree Hill Season 6 Episode 19

One Tree Hill: While Julian makes Brooke a surprising offer, Lucas takes Nathan and Jamie to an important place from his past. Meanwhile, Peyton prepares for the future; Sam and Jack go up against the principal who fired Haley; and Skills and Mouth go on a road trip to help Mouth forget Millie.

Starring:

Barry Corbin, Craig Sheffer, Chad Michael Murray, Sophia Bush, Robert Buckley, Paul Johansson, Moira Kelly, Bethany Joy Lenz, James Lafferty, Austin Nichols, Jana Kramer, 9 more, Stephen Colletti, Danneel Ackles, Antwon Tanner, Shantel VanSanten, Barbara Alyn Woods, Jackson Brundage, Lee Norris, Hilarie Burton Morgan, Lisa Goldstein Kirsch

Genre:

Drama


View Trailer


Similar

Watch One Tree Hill Season 06 Episode 19 123movies for free in HD quality. Stream instantly with English subtitles — no download or account needed.